WebFeb 13, 2024 · Dog Bribe = relying on showing your dog food in order to get a response. What's the problem? If the thing your dog wants to do is more motivating than your food, you lose! Dog Reward = the paycheck that comes AFTER the dog has responded successfully to a cue you've previously taught. Dog Lure = Using food for a SHORT period of time in the ... WebOct 23, 2024 · In continuous reinforcement, you would reward the dog every time they sat. In random reinforcement, you only reward the dog every few times - the schedule should be random and unpredictable. Sentient beings love to gamble and using a random schedule builds behaviour faster and holds it longer than even continuous reinforcement.
